Lamoni's game on Tuesday was a loss, but they didn't let that memory haunt them on Wednesday. They came out on top against the East Union Eagles by a score of 10-5. The high-flying hitting performance was a huge turnaround for the Demons considering their two-run performance the matchup before.

Lamoni's win ended a four-game drought on the road and puts them at 3-7. As for East Union, they are on a six-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 4-11.
Lamoni has already played their next game, a 20-0 victory against Moulton-Udell on the 19th. East Union has also already played their next contest (against Southwest Valley),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ing.
